// Heads up: this client talks to the Sproutly scheduler, which decides
// when each office planter gets watered. If the greenhouse sensors in
// Building Fern go quiet, the scheduler falls back to a fixed cadence,
// so don't panic if you see duplicate watering jobs overnight.
// Retries are handled upstream by the Mistline queue — don't add your own.
// The client needs the internal Sproutly key, which goes right below.

gateway credential: kto3_qfe

## Who to Contact: EXIF Scrubbing

All uploaded images in Quillport must pass through the Strippet EXIF scrubber before publishing. Do not write your own metadata removal — use the shared pipeline. If scrubbing fails or you see location data surviving in output files, stop the upload job immediately. Config questions go to the Strippet maintainers in the Pipeline Guild. For access or bug reports, email the on-duty maintainer.

alerts address for bajop-yahog: istwyn@lumiclabs.internal

14:22 — On-call engineer Priya from the Larkspur platform team confirmed that the Heliograph schema registry was rejecting all new event schema registrations with a version-conflict error. She traced the issue to a compaction job that had reordered subject versions overnight. Writes were paused cluster-wide as a precaution while reads continued normally. The exact registry build running at the time is recorded below.

build token for tawip-yageg: htk9_92ac43d42

**Ticket: Staging validators silently skipping everything**

For the eng sync: the Pipewren plugin system for data validators is misconfigured on staging. Turns out `VALIDATOR_PLUGIN_DIR` still points at the old `plugins/v1` path, so the loader finds zero plugins and happily validates nothing. Fun. Fix is easy — point it at `plugins/v2` and restart the worker. While we're in there, the plugin registry fetch also fails because the env file is missing its auth credential, which should be added on the line after this sentence:

secret setting of yagef-baweg: RELAY_SECRET29=cb53deb59a49ed54d9f43599b54ca